Lanier to address Memorial Day service

The Willoughby Marks American Legion Post 106 will host a Memorial Day service.

The service will start at 10 a.m. this Monday, May 30, and will be held at the Three Servicemen Statue Detail in Apalachicola’s Veterans Plaza.

Guest speaker will be Franklin County Schools Superintendent Steve Lanier who is a retired commander in the U.S. Navy.

The entire community is invited to pay tribute to the many men and women who have given their lives to preserve the freedoms and liberty found in the United States of America.
